32位操作系统开启大内存 - 读SQL Server2008查询性能优化有感

楼主
我是社区第28744位番薯,欢迎点我头像关注我哦~
32位操作系统开启大内存 - 读 SQL Server2008查询性能优化 有感

64位系统就没有这个限制了,问题是我的系统还真的就是32位的,目前也没有时间来重装。
如果是2003之类的,需要在boot.ini加上开关
如果内存在 4G一下,加上 /3GB开关
如果是4G以上,加上/PAE
然后sql server 打开awe支持。
重新启动
如果是2008的话
  1. 1、进入CMD
  2. 2、输入:BCDEdit /set PAE forceenable
  3. 3、完成重启计算机。
复制代码

另一个详细一点的文档:
PAE就好啦,以下是具体操作系统步骤:
  1.   1、以系统管理员的身份打开“Command Prompt” 即CMD
  2.   2、使用命令bcdedit /enum all来查看你的操作系统引导项的名字,一般是{default}
  3.   3、保用命令bcdedit /set {default} PAE ForceEnable
  4.      注意:{default}中的default是你的系统的引导项identifier的值。
复制代码
好啦,现在重新启动你的电脑,这样你可以放心使用它啦。不用担心你的内存不会被充分利用。

方法2.:修改注册表来实现注册表位置和修改参数如下
  1. H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Session Manager\Memory
  2. PhysicalAddressExtension 修改DWORD 值
  3. 是 (0),PAE 被禁用;
  4. 值为(1),启用 PAE
复制代码



分享扩散:

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

返回顶部 返回列表